If buckwheat is cooked from scratch, then you can put in the multicooker all raw and cold products. If cereal is added to hot, fried vegetables, meat or other ingredients, then boiling water should be added, regardless of whether water is used or broth.

In the multicooker for buckwheat there is a special program. But not in all models it is so called. Sometimes the modes are designated "Porridge", "Pilaf", they are also suitable for cooking.

Buckwheat porridge in a slow cooker for a side dish

A method of cooking ordinary buckwheat porridge, which is great for a garnish for meat, fish. A cup of cereal will produce 3-4 servings. If you need more, then proportionally increase the ingredients, including water.

Ingredients

• a glass of buckwheat;

• two glasses of water;

• 30-50 grams of butter;

• salt.

Cooking

1. Rinse buckwheat, select damaged and unpeeled grains, discard.

2. Lay the cereal in the slow cooker, add two glasses of water, throw half a piece of oil. Be sure to salt.

3. Close, cook before the signal.

4. At the end, run the remaining oil, you can throw a bay leaf, a clove of garlic under the cover. Close, let the porridge brew. Throw the laurel and garlic before serving.

Buckwheat porridge in a slow cooker with mushrooms

A variant of chic buckwheat porridge in a slow cooker with an amazing aroma of forest mushrooms, although you can use ordinary champignons. If you use vegetable oil, you get a lean version of the dish.

Ingredients

• 0.2 kg of boiled mushrooms;

• 1.5 multi-glasses of buckwheat;

• 2 onion heads;

• 3 such glasses of boiling water;

• 40 g of oil;

• spices.

Cooking

1. Throw oil into the multicooker bowl, turn on the baking. Or pour vegetable oil.

2. Shred a couple of onion heads, you can cut into cubes or straws. Throw in oil, fry for about five minutes. If butter is used, then the blush will appear faster.

3. Boil mushrooms in boiling water. If you replace the product with mushrooms, then you can not do this. Then cut into convenient pieces, do not chop.

4. We shift the mushrooms to the onion. Also lightly fry.

5. It's time to season with spices. Salt, pepper, you can add garlic sweet paprika.

6. Run the prepared cereal.

7. Add water according to the recipe.

8. It remains only to close the saucepan and switch to buckwheat mode. Waiting for a signal! Stir the prepared porridge so that the mushrooms are evenly distributed.

Buckwheat porridge in a slow cooker with vegetables

A variant of juicy porridge for those who do not want to cook gravy. Wonderful side dish to sausage or cutlet.

Ingredients

• 2 onions;

• 1.5 cups of buckwheat;

• 1 carrot;

• 1 pepper;

• 50 ml of oil;

• 3 cups boiling water;

• laurel, spices.

Cooking

1. All vegetables need to be washed, peeled, seeds removed from pepper. You can cut the products into cubes, straws, or in any other way, but it is better not to grind it so that the pieces are clearly visible in the porridge.

2. Pour oil. Set the frying and warm. Lay vegetables alternately with an interval of five minutes: onions, carrots, peppers.

3. Another five minutes later to them we throw the cereals, previously washed.

4. Pour boiling water. If you want to get more crumbly and dry porridge, then pour a little less than three glasses. For juicy buckwheat with prescription pouring.

5. Season the future porridge with spices. Here you can turn on imagination and throw everything you love.

6. Put a laurel on top, do not forget about the salt.

7. Close, switch to the appropriate mode of porridge or buckwheat, wait. The slow cooker will inform you about the readiness of the dish.

Buckwheat porridge in a slow cooker with stew

Option soldier buckwheat porridge in a slow cooker with the addition of ordinary stew. If the dish is not very tasty in the army, then the home version is completely different.

Ingredients

• can of stew;

• onion;

• 2 cups cereals;

• carrot;

• 4 cups of water;

• spices.

Cooking

1. Open the stew. A thick layer of fat appears before us. It needs to be removed. It is suitable for frying vegetables. If fat is low, although this is extremely rare, then add a little oil to it.

2. Heat the fat using pastries.

3. Throw onion, passer.

4. Add the carrots, fry with it.

5. In the stew, knead large pieces of meat or cut. We shift to vegetables. We are warming up. The liquid can be evaporated or left. If a lot of jelly has melted, then it will be necessary to reduce part of the water indicated in the recipe.

6. We start buckwheat.

7. Add spices and boiling water. Stir, smooth the layer with a spatula.

Close, cook porridge until the signal.

Buckwheat porridge in a slow cooker with chicken and soy sauce

The recipe for a wonderful porridge in which chicken fillet goes. We take the breast from one chicken and any soy sauce.

Ingredients

• 2 multi-glasses of buckwheat;

• 4 multi-glasses of water;

• 1 breast;

• 2 onion heads;

• 30 ml of oil;

• 4-5 tablespoons of sauce;

Cooking

1. Peeled onion cut into half rings.

2. We heat the oil. To do this, turn on the miracle pan for the baking program.

3. Lay the onions, fry until rosy.

4. Cut the breast with cubes a centimeter thick, pour the sauce and let it lie down while the onions are being prepared, you can immediately sprinkle with spices for the bird.

5. Run the breast to the onion, brown the buns for about five minutes.

6. Add the cereal and water, stir. Throw a little salt, as soy sauce will not be enough to prepare so many products.

7. Close, cook in buckwheat mode, but not until the very end. After 25 minutes, turn off the multicooker, otherwise the chicken will dry out, and the pieces of the breast will become stiff.

8. Insist porridge without opening the saucepan, about half an hour. Then the dish will need to be stirred.

Buckwheat porridge in a slow cooker with egg and peas

No meat? And without it, you can cook a very tasty and satisfying porridge. A lack of protein compensates for the boiled egg. You can cook it in advance. Peas can be taken canned or frozen.

Ingredients

• onion head;

• boiled egg (as much as possible);

• a glass of buckwheat;

• half a glass of peas;

• water;

• spices, laurel;

• 2 tablespoons of oil.

Cooking

1. Peel the onion. Cut the head into small cubes, passer in oil. If you want to get a more fatty dish, then add more oil. Baking programs.

2. Now we throw washed buckwheat to the onion, add water (boiling water) at the rate of 2 parts per grits. Salt, pepper.

3. Close, turn on the porridge program and cook for 15 minutes.

4. Open, add green peas, stir, put the laurel on top, close and cook until done.

5. During this time, we clean the egg, you can use more than one. Cut into cubes.

6. Put the egg in an almost ready porridge, you can immediately get the laurel. Warm up together.

7. Before serving, you need to stir the dish, you can additionally season with a piece of butter.

Buckwheat porridge in a slow cooker - useful tips and tricks

• When cooking porridge, you can also steam sausages or small patties. Just place the tray over the products loaded for porridge, put the sausages or cutlets, close the slow cooker and cook in cereal mode until the signal. Very convenient and easy.

• Buckwheat porridge will be tastier if you fry the washed cereals in a dry pan. But in no case do it in a dry slow cooker, you can spoil the saucepan.

• Buckwheat loves butter, including ghee. But along with this, she can absorb it indefinitely. Professional chefs recommend not to put all the butter in the boil, just add a small piece, and the remaining product is better to run into the finished porridge. You can throw a piece at the end or already after the signal under the cover of the multicooker and after a few minutes stir.
